Best time to go to Lake Placid

The best time to visit Lake Placid is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is very c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January16.2°F (-8.8°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ageAverage
February18.1°F (-7.7°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ageSlightly High
March26.2°F (-3.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April38.5°F (3.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
May52.7°F (11.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
June59.9°F (15.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August63.9°F (17.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
September57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October45.5°F (7.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
November32.7°F (0.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
December23.9°F (-4.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Lake Placid

For visiting Lake Placid, New York, the nearest major airports are Burlington, VT (BTV-Burlington Intl.) and Plattsburgh, NY (PBG-Plattsburgh Intl.). Burlington Airport is approximately 69.2km away, with nearby hotels such as the 4-star DoubleTree by Hilton Burlington, 3.2km from the airport, offering transportation services. Plattsburgh Airport is about 59.5km away, with options like the 3-star Best Western Plus Plattsburgh, located 4.8km from the airport. Additionally, Massena, NY (MSS-Massena Intl.) is situated 63.2km from Lake Placid, featuring motels such as the Blue Spruce Motel, 3.2km from the airport, providing convenient access for travellers.

What is there to see in Lake Placid?

Cultural venues include Lake Placid Winter Olympic Museum and Lake Placid Center for the Arts. Landmarks like Lake Placid Adirondack Scenic Railroad Station and John Brown Farm State Historic Site might be worth a visit. The lakeside and mountain views highlight the natural beauty with places to discover including Lake Placid Public Beach, Mirror Lake and Ausable River. What's the seasonal weather like in Lake Placid?

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-6°C. The snowiest months in Lake Placid are January, December, March and February, with each month seeing an average of 47 cm of snowfall.
